ORDER : The Court Made the following order :- The petitioner is in custody since 12.07.2018 for the offence punishable under Sections 324, 302 IPC @ 147, 148, 324, 302 IPC r/w 120(B) IPC @ 324 and 302 IPC r/w 34 IPC on the file of the respondent police.
2.Heard the learned counsel appearing for the petitioner and the learned Government Advocate (Crl. side) appearing for the respondent Police.
3.This Court had dismissed the petitioner's earlier Bail petition, since the committal proceedings were still pending. Now, it is submitted that the committal proceedings is over. Hence, bail is granted.
4.This Court is inclined to grant bail to the petitioner, but with certain conditions. Accordingly, this Criminal Original Petition is allowed and the petitioner is ordered to be released on bail, subject to the following conditions:

(i) the petitioner shall execute a bond for a sum of Rs.10,000/- (Rupees Ten Thousand Only) with two sureties, each for a like sum to the satisfaction of the Judicial Magistrate No.II, Pudukottai.
(ii) the petitioner is directed to appear before the respondent police as and when required for interrogation. (iii) on breach of any of the aforesaid conditions, the Magistrate / Trial Court is entitled to take appropriate action against the petitioner in accordance with law as if the conditions have been imposed and the petitioner on bail by the Magistrate / Trial Court himself as laid down by the Hon'ble Supreme Court in P.K.Shaji vs. State of Kerala [(2005) AIR SCW 5560].
